RESUMO

PURPOSE: A positive fluid balance (FB) is associated with harm in intensive care unit (ICU) patients with acute kidney injury (AKI). We aimed to understand how a positive balance develops in such patients. METHODS: Multinational, retrospective cohort study of critically ill patients with AKI not requiring renal replacement therapy. RESULTS: AKI occurred at a median of two days after admission in 7894 (17.3%) patients. Cumulative FB became progressively positive, peaking on day three despite only 848 (10.7%) patients receiving fluid resuscitation in the ICU. In those three days, persistent crystalloid use (median:60.0 mL/h; IQR 28.9-89.2), nutritional intake (median:18.2 mL/h; IQR 0.0-45.9) and limited urine output (UO) (median:70.8 mL/h; IQR 49.0-96.7) contributed to a positive FB. Although UO increased each day, it failed to match input, with only 797 (10.1%) patients receiving diuretics in ICU. After adjustment, a positive FB four days after AKI diagnosis was associated with an increased risk of hospital mortality (OR 1.12;95% confidence intervals 1.05-1.19;p-value <0.001). CONCLUSION: Among ICU patients with AKI, cumulative FB increased after diagnosis and was associated with an increased risk of mortality. Continued crystalloid administration, increased nutritional intake, limited UO, and minimal use of diuretics all contributed to positive FB. KEY POINTS: Question How does a positive fluid balance develop in critically ill patients with acute kidney injury? Findings Cumulative FB increased after AKI diagnosis and was secondary to persistent crystalloid fluid administration, increasing nutritional fluid intake, and insufficient urine output. Despite the absence of resuscitation fluid and an increasing cumulative FB, there was persistently low diuretics use, ongoing crystalloid use, and a progressive escalation of nutritional fluid therapy. Meaning Current management results in fluid accumulation after diagnosis of AKI, as a result of ongoing crystalloid administration, increasing nutritional fluid, limited urine output and minimal diuretic use.

RESUMO

BACKGROUND: China contributes to almost half of the esophageal cancer cases diagnosed globally each year. However, the prognosis information of this disease in this large population is scarce. METHODS: Data on a population-based cohort consisting of residents of Shandong Province, China who were diagnosed with esophageal cancer during the period from 2005 to 2014 were analyzed. The cancer-specific survival rates were estimated using Kaplan-Meier analysis. Discrete-time multilevel mixed-effects survival models were used to investigate socioeconomic status (SES) disparities on esophageal cancer survival. RESULTS: The unadjusted 1-, 3-, and 5-year cause-specific survival rates were 59.6% [95% confidence interval (CI), 59.2%-59.9%], 31.9% (95% CI, 31.5%-32.3%), and 23.6% (95% CI, 23.1%-24.0%), respectively. Patients of blue-collar occupations had higher risk of esophageal cancer-related death than those of white-collar occupations in the first 2 years after diagnosis. Rural patients had higher risk of death than urban patients in the first 3 years after diagnosis. The risks of esophageal cancer-related death among patients living in low/middle/high SES index counties were not different in the first 2 years after diagnosis. However, patients living in high SES index counties had better long-term survival (3-5 years postdiagnosis) than those living in middle or low SES index counties. CONCLUSIONS: Socioeconomic inequalities in esophageal cancer survival exist in this Chinese population. Higher individual- or area-level SES is associated with better short-term or long-term cancer survival. IMPACT: Elucidation of the relative roles of the SES factors on survival could guide interventions to reduce disparities in the prognosis of esophageal cancer.

RESUMO

Esophageal cancer (EC) is a leading cause of cancer death in China. Within Shandong Province, a geographic cluster with high EC mortality has been identified, however little is known about how area-level socioeconomic status (SES) is associated with EC mortality in this province. Multilevel models were applied to EC mortality data in 2011-13 among Shandong residents aged 40+ years. Area-level SES factors consisted of residential type (urban/rural) of the sub-county-level units (n = 262) and SES index (range: 0-10) of the county-level units (n = 142). After adjustment for age and sex, residents living in rural areas had a 22% (95% CI: 13-32%) higher risk of dying from EC than those in urban areas. With each unit increase in the SES index, the average risk of dying from EC reduced by 10% (95% CI: 3-18%). The adjustment of area-level SES variables had little impact on the risk ratio of EC mortality between the high-mortality cluster and the rest of Shandong. In conclusion, rural residence and lower SES index are strongly associated with elevated risks of EC death. However, these factors are independent of the high mortality in the cluster area of Shandong. The underlying causes for this geographic disparity need to be further investigated.

RESUMO

False-negative results for Plasmodium falciparum histidine-rich protein (HRP) 2-based rapid diagnostic tests (RDTs) are increasing in Eritrea. We investigated HRP gene 2/3 (pfhrp2/pfhrp3) status in 50 infected patients at 2 hospitals. We showed that 80.8% (21/26) of patients at Ghindae Hospital and 41.7% (10/24) at Massawa Hospital were infected with pfhrp2-negative parasites and 92.3% (24/26) of patients at Ghindae Hospital and 70.8% (17/24) at Massawa Hospital were infected with pfhrp3-negative parasites. Parasite densities between pfhrp2-positive and pfhrp2-negative patients were comparable. All pfhrp2-negative samples had no detectable HRP2/3 antigen and showed negative results for HRP2-based RDTs. pfhrp2-negative parasites were genetically less diverse and formed 2 clusters with no close relationships to parasites from Peru. These parasites probably emerged independently by selection in Eritrea. High prevalence of pfhrp2-negative parasites caused a high rate of false-negative results for RDTs. Determining prevalence of pfhrp2-negative parasites is urgently needed in neighboring countries to assist case management policies.

RESUMO

BACKGROUND: The development of a comprehensive and detailed model of the musculature of the lumbar region is required if biomechanical models are to accurately predict the forces and moments experienced by the lumbar spine. METHODS: A new anatomical model representing the nine major muscles of the lumbar spine and the thoracolumbar fascia is presented. These nine muscles are modeled as numerous fascicles, each with its own force producing potential based on size and line of action. The simulated spine is fully deformable, allowing rotation in any direction, while respecting the physical constraints imposed by the skeletal structure. Maximal moments were predicted by implementing the model using a pseudo force distribution algorithm. Three types of surgery that affect the spinal musculature were simulated: posterior spinal surgery, anterior surgery, and total hip replacement. FINDINGS: Predicted moments matched published data from maximum isometric exertions in male volunteers. The biomechanical changes for the three different types of surgery demonstrated several common features: decreased spinal compression and production of asymmetric moments during symmetric tasks. INTERPRETATION: This type of analysis provides new opportunities to explore the effect of different patterns of muscle activity including muscle injury on the biomechanics of the spine.

RESUMO

Immunizing pregnant women with a malaria vaccine is one approach to protecting the mother and her offspring from malaria infection. However, specific maternal Abs generated in response to vaccination and transferred to the fetus may interfere with the infant's ability to respond to the same vaccine. Using a murine model of malaria, we examined the effect of maternal 19-kDa C-terminal region of merozoite surface protein-1 (MSP1(19)) and Plasmodium yoelii Abs on the pups' ability to respond to immunization with MSP1(19). Maternal MSP1(19)-specific Abs but not P. yoelii-specific Abs inhibited Ab production following MSP1(19) immunization in 2-wk-old pups. This inhibition was correlated with the amount of maternal MSP1(19) Ab present in the pup at the time of immunization and was due to fewer specific B cells. Passively acquired Ab most likely inhibited the development of an Ab response by blocking access to critical B cell epitopes. If a neonate's ability to respond to MSP1(19) vaccination depends on the level of maternal Abs present at the time of vaccination, it may be necessary to delay immunization until Abs specific for the vaccinating Ag have decreased.
